Transaction c0e8b66d83a39ae66118079e827e3bd3b524a74a90bff1deb96e337c4f8d820a
1 Input
1 Output
-
c0e8b66d83a39ae66118079e827e3bd3b524a74a90bff1deb96e337c4f8d820a:0
- value
- 660423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4eb29f17ba4d30e417a155dfb0d16101326d8ef9 OP_EQUAL
- address
- 38s8cLqcJhkbtrisT5FNMjvy3L9C2i4BVT